Informed Consent
1. Informed consent is part of being truthful to our clients which we are bound to do so ethically.
2. Informed consent involves the right of clients to be informed about their therapy/assessment and to make autonomous decisions.
3. Informed consent's main purpose is to increase the chances that the client will become involved, educated and a willing participant in the assessment and therapy. Resistance can yield unproductive results for both assessment and therapy.
